The aircraft’s construction number and Imperial Japanese Naval Air Service serial number are currently unknown, but it had the squadron tail number 302 for the 105th Naval Base Air Unit at Vunakanau Airfield, near Rabaul, New Britain. Nakajima B5N2 ‘Kate’, tail number 302, at Vunakanau Airfield, New Britain, September 1945.

Among the squadron’s aircraft was F/A-18C 163502, VFA-81 squadron tail code AA-410, which was flown by Lieutenant Nick “Mongo” Mongillo at the controls. On January 17, 1991, VFA-81 participated in the first daytime airstrike of Operation Desert Storm.
